Public storm report tables connected to the August 15, 2024 hail map for Albany, NY currently list 6 public hail reports, 14 public wind reports, and 0 tornado reports.
| Date & Time | Hail Size |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
August 15, 2024 3:42 PM CT |
1.50 in | Halls Corner | NY | Near Raspbery Dr. |
August 15, 2024 3:50 PM CT |
1.50 in | 2 N Round Lake | NY | Social Media report with video of ping pong ball sized hail falling in the town of Malta. The period of the Hail event was 10 minutes. |
August 15, 2024 3:53 PM CT |
1.75 in | 2 N Round Lake | NY | Received a report from Media partner of estimated hail size of golf ball in the town of Malta. Time is based on radar. |
August 15, 2024 3:55 PM CT |
1.00 in | Malta | NY | Near Route 9 in Malta. |
August 15, 2024 4:40 PM CT |
1.00 in | Suffield | CT | Report of quarter-sized hail in the northeast section of Suffield. Time estimated via radar. |
August 15, 2024 4:55 PM CT |
1.75 in | 4 NNE Hudson Falls | NY | Delayed report received from broadcast media. Time estimated from radar. |
| Date & Time | Wind Speed |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
August 15, 2024 3:19 PM CT | 2 WSW Springfield | MA | In Springfield... a tree fell down on a car on Dwight St. Person inside was freed and is OK according to fire dept. Relayed via amateur radio. | |
August 15, 2024 3:53 PM CT | 2 NNE Round Lake | NY | Received a report of downed tree on house in the town of Malta. | |
August 15, 2024 4:01 PM CT | 2 ESE Ballston Spa | NY | Tree down across East High St. | |
August 15, 2024 4:20 PM CT | Malta | NY | Tree and Wires Down on Route 9 and Dunning Rd. | |
August 15, 2024 4:36 PM CT | 1 WSW Fort Ann | NY | Received report of trees and wires down along State Route 149 in the town of Fort Ann. Time based on radar. | |
August 15, 2024 4:40 PM CT | 4 SSW Fort Ann | NY | Received multiple reports of trees and wires down in the town of Kingsbury. Time based on radar. | |
August 15, 2024 4:45 PM CT | 4 NE Hudson Falls | NY | Tree & Wires Down on Hendee Rd. | |
August 15, 2024 4:49 PM CT | 4 NNE Hudson Falls | NY | Corrects previous tstm wnd dmg report from 4 NNE Hudson Falls. Tree down blocking road on State Route 4. | |
August 15, 2024 4:52 PM CT | 3 NE Hudson Falls | NY | Tree and Wires Down on County Route 41 in Kingsbury. | |
August 15, 2024 4:55 PM CT | 1 NNE Hudson Falls | NY | Trees & Wires Down on East Labarge St. | |
August 15, 2024 4:57 PM CT | 1 ENE Hudson Falls | NY | Tree Down with road blocked on Burgoyne Ave/County Route 41. | |
August 15, 2024 4:59 PM CT | 1 SSW Hudson Falls | NY | Tree Down on Lower Main St in Ft. Edward. | |
August 15, 2024 5:05 PM CT | 1 ENE Hudson Falls | NY | Received report of trees and wires down along Melony Lane. Time based on radar. | |
August 15, 2024 5:06 PM CT | 1 ESE Hudson Falls | NY | Received report of trees down on power lines along Burgoyne Ave in Hudson Falls. Time based on radar. |
